Theme
I would say the overall theme of this piece is the importance of doing the right thing, no matter what the cost. Rules are important. Without them we wouldn't be able to function, yet doing the right thing sometimes needs to be more important than rules.
In this book Harry has a knack for breaking rules. Sometimes it wasn't needed, and he was rightfully punished. However, there were times when he had to. Imagine this story if Harry and Ron hadn't broken a rule and saved Hermione, or if they hadn't gone into the restricted section of the library, or if they hadn't traveled to the forbidden area, and the list goes on and on.
Occasionally, a rebel is needed. Someone who will follow their gut, and do what they feel is best.
